Template:Ratings Gladsheim was a city on the planet of Harvest [1] That was the second city attacked by the Covenant on Harvest. There was one known person to survive the Covenant's attack.

Trivia

In Norse Mythology, Gladsheim is actually a realm of Asgard where Odin's hall, Valhalla is located, coincidentally a Multiplayer map in Halo 3.
